What is an Operations KPI? An Operations Key Performance Indicator (KPI) or metric is a discrete measurement that a company uses to monitor and evaluate the efficiency of its day-to-day operations. These operations KPIs help management identify which operational strategies are effective, and those that inhibit the company.

What is a Real Estate KPI? A real estate Key Performance Indicator (KPI) or metric is a quantifiable measure used to assess the performance of a business in the real estate industry. This KPI determines the number of years it will take for a property to pay back the initial investment amount. Real Estate Agent KPIs.

What Is an Insurance KPI? An insurance Key Performance Indicator (KPI) or metric is a measure that an insurance company uses to monitor its performance and efficiency.
